Address bc1pxqcqjd7l3qc40kwls4z4d46s07m39fnw4tf6wjselx9rc98rmgssjmrw4j

sat balance
299628
rune balances
DEPIN•ECO•DEAI: 0.01𝓓
DEPIN•RUNE•DEAI: 20184.94609423𝔻
outputs